A Tender Moment

Emerald pines and jade laurels Crisp, cool air misting beyond the range Of peaks that ascend to meet The clear, indigo heavens complete With bleached snowy puffs of cotton Drifting into silhouettes, characters Both soft and yearning – floating Into the horizon where they play Dancing through the impression Of a peaceful, tender moment God’s artistic hand pressing down Against the Appalachian mountains
